Abstract

This is a neurostimulator that is configured to treat epilepsy and other neurological disorders using certain stimulation strategies, particularly changing various pulse parameters, during the imposition of a burst of those pulses. The invention includes the processes embodying those stimulation strategies.

Claims (15)

1. A method for treating an abnormal neurological condition comprising:

detecting electrical activity of brain tissue wherein the detected electrical activity is characterized by at least one detected parameter;

applying a plurality of bursts of electrical stimulation to the brain tissue, wherein each burst of the plurality of bursts comprises a determined number of electrical pulses being characterizable by a plurality of burst parameters; and

varying at least one of the burst parameters during at least a portion of the time the plurality of bursts of electrical stimulation is applied to vary the bursts so that the burst parameters of at least one burst of the plurality of bursts are different from the burst parameters of at least one other burst of the plurality of bursts, wherein the varying is based on a timing of the at least one detected parameter.

2. The method of claim 1 further including varying at least one of the burst parameters based on the timing of the at least one detected parameter relative to a timing of an application of the at least one burst of the plurality of bursts.

3. The method of claim 1 wherein the at least one detected parameter is a pulse-to-pulse interval and the method further includes varying at least one of the burst parameters of the plurality of burst parameters based on the detected pulse-to-pulse interval.

4. A method for treating an abnormal neurological condition comprising:

detecting electrical activity of brain tissue wherein the detected electrical activity is characterized by at least one detected parameter;

applying a plurality of bursts of electrical stimulation to the brain tissue, wherein each burst of the plurality of bursts comprises a determined number of electrical pulses being characterizable by a plurality of burst parameters and at least one burst of the plurality of bursts is applied at a time that is synchronized to a time at which the at least one detected parameter is detected; and

varying at least one of the burst parameters during at least a portion of the time the plurality of burst parameters of electrical stimulation is applied to vary the bursts so that the burst parameters of at least one burst of the plurality of bursts are different from the burst parameters of at least one other burst of the plurality of bursts.

5. A method for treating an abnormal neurological condition comprising:

detecting a rate of electrical activity in signals sensed from brain tissue;

identifying an interval corresponding to the detected rate;

applying a plurality of bursts of electrical stimulation to the brain tissue, wherein each burst of the plurality of bursts comprises a determined number of electrical pulses being characterizable by a plurality of burst parameters and at least one burst of the plurality of bursts is applied based on detection of the interval; and

varying at least one of the burst parameters during at least a portion of a time the plurality of bursts of electrical stimulation is applied to vary the bursts so that the burst parameters of at least one burst of the plurality of bursts are different from the burst parameters of at least one other burst of the plurality of bursts.
